Checking Electric Compatibility



To ensure a successful heatpump installation, it's essential to examine the electrical compatibility of your marked installation area. Begin by making https://www.cnet.com/home/energy-and-utilities/how-to-lower-your-air-conditioning-bill-while-youre-away-on-vacation/ that your electrical panel has the capacity to support the brand-new heatpump. visit this web page link if there suffice offered circuit breakers and sufficient amperage to take care of the additional load. If required, consult with a qualified electrical expert to analyze and update your electric system.



Next, validate if the voltage demands of the heatpump match your home's electric supply. Many heat pumps operate conventional home voltage, however it's necessary to verify this to avoid any electric concerns during setup. Furthermore, make certain that the electrical wiring in your house is in good condition and meets the specifications described by the heat pump maker.

Finally, consider the area of the nearest source of power to the outside system of the heatpump. It should be available for very easy link without the need for comprehensive wiring. By resolving these electric compatibility variables beforehand, you can ensure a smooth and effective heatpump installation process.
